Sarnia's Canada Day fireworks contract extended to 2028

The City of Sarnia has extended its contract with a pyrotechnic company, which will see the cost of Canada Day fireworks hover around $35,000 per year over the next four years.

The city's Canada Day committee has worked with Garden City Fireworks since 2013.

An agreement entered in 2018 allowed for a four-year optional extension, as such the contract has been extended to 2028.

The total cost amounts to $141,853 and will be funded through the Canada Day - Fireworks budget.

A breakdown of the costs under the four-year agreement are listed below. 

2025 - $33,450

2026 - $34,950

2027 - $35,500

2028 - $35,500
